КАТЕГОРИИ:
АстрономияБиологияГеографияДругие языкиДругоеИнформатикаИсторияКультураЛитератураЛогикаМатематикаМедицинаМеханикаОбразованиеОхрана трудаПедагогикаПолитикаПравоПсихологияРиторикаСоциологияСпортСтроительствоТехнологияФизикаФилософияФинансыХимияЧерчениеЭкологияЭкономикаЭлектроника
|
Что дальше? На этом мы закончим разговор о Web-дизайне и начнем говорить о Web-программированииНа этом мы закончим разговор о Web-дизайне и начнем говорить о Web-программировании. Удивлены? Скажете, что мы вроде бы уже говорили о программировании в Интернете в главе 7J? Да, говорили. Те программы, которые мы писали ранее, работали на стороне клиента, под управлением Web-обозревателя и виртуальной машины. Но знаете ли вы, что можно писать программы, которые будут работать на стороне Web-сервера? Эти программы будут принимать от посетителя сайта какие-либо данные, обрабатывать их и выдавать результат в виде сформированной самой программой Web-страницы. Заинтригованы? Тогда читайте дальше.
· ЧАСТЬ IV. ПИШЕМ СЕРВЕРНЫЕ ПРОГРАММЫ o Глава 15. Введение в серверное программирование § Что такое серверное программирование § Зачем нужны серверные программы § Как Web-сервер обрабатывает данные пользователя § Как Web-обозреватель отправляет введенные данные § Как данные передаются по Сети § Серверное программирование — подход Dreamweaver § Введение в базы данных § Что дальше? ЧАСТЬ IV. Пишем серверные программы · Глава 15. Введение в серверное программирование · Глава 16. Формы · Глава 17. Простейшие серверные приложения · Глава 18. Создание интерактивных сайтов ГЛАВА 15. Введение в серверное программирование Что? Какое еще серверное программирование? Что это за беда? И зачем она нам нужна? Мы, вроде бы, научились создавать Web-страницы в среде Dreamweaver. Мы даже научились создавать с его помощью целые Web-сайты и публиковать их на Web-сервере. Мы изучили две разновидности дизайна страниц: фреймовый, когда сайты строятся на основе наборов фреймов, и табличный, когда содержимое страницы помещается в большую сложную таблицу. Мы познакомились с таблицами стилей, метатегами и серверными директивами. И, наконец, узнали о Web-программировании и Web-сценариях, позволяющих добавить "жизни" нашим статичным страничкам. Что же еще надо для счастья? Да, изученного ранее нам вполне хватит, чтобы создавать вполне приличные сайты. Многие Web-дизайнеры на этом и останавливаются. Но ведь мы хотим большего, не так ли? Так давайте же сделаем следующий шаг — перейдем от страниц, хранящихся в файлах на сервере, к страницам, генерируемым специальными программами. Как раз написанием таких программ и занимается серверное программирование. Но давайте по порядку. И начнем мы с того, что выясним, зачем нужны эти серверные программы. Что такое серверное программирование Действительно, что это такое и с чем его едят?
|